  • Writers at Wolfe with Elizabeth Kostova

    Elizabeth Kostova author of The Historian, The Swan Thieves, and her latest novel The Shadow Land, discusses Thomas Wolfe’s influence on her as a writer and reader and reads a fascinating autobiographical short story.   • Writers at Wolfe with Thomas McConnell

    Join us as Thomas McConnell discusses Thomas Wolfe’s influence on him as a writer and reads from his debut novel The Wooden King. With rich historical detail McConnell dramatically explores a family facing the rise of totalitarianism in Czechoslovakia during World War II. Free!   • Writers at Wolfe with Terry Roberts

    Join us as Terry Roberts discusses Thomas Wolfe’s influence on him as a writer and reads from his third novel, The Holy Ghost Speakeasy and Revival, just released in August of 2018. The novel introduces preacher Jedidiah Robbins’s Gospel revival as it travels through 1920s Western North Carolina spreading the Gospel and illegal moonshine. Free! […]
